Выбор версии платформы 1С:Предприятие — это фундаментальное решение, от которого зависит скорость работы вашей учетной системы, возможность масштабирования и совместимость с новыми конфигурациями. Ошибка на этом этапе может привести к тому, что через полгода вы столкнетесь с необходимостью дорогостоящего переноса баз данных или неспособностью обновиться до актуальных форм отчетности. В текущем ландшафте программного обеспечения выбор стоит не просто между номерами версий, а между различными архитектурными подходами к хранению и обработке данных.
Многие предприниматели ошибочно полагают, что достаточно установить последнюю доступную версию, игнорируя аппаратные возможности сервера и количество одновременных пользователей. На самом деле, переход на новую ветку развития, такую как платформа 8.4, требует тщательной проверки совместимости с используемыми конфигурациями и операционными системами. В этой статье мы детально разберем критерии выбора, технические нюансы и скрытые подводные камни миграции.
Прежде чем переходить к техническим деталям, необходимо определиться с масштабом задачи: работаете ли вы в однопользовательском режиме или нуждаетесь в многопользовательском доступе с разграничением прав. От этого ответа будет зависеть выбор между файловой и клиент-серверной архитектурой, что является первым и самым важным шагом в планировании инфраструктуры.
Ключевые отличия версий 8.3 и 8.4
Долгое время стандартом де-факто являлась ветка 8.3, которая обеспечивала стабильность и предсказуемость работы большинства типовых и отраслевых решений. Однако с выходом версии 8.4 разработчики внедрили ряд архитектурных изменений, направленных на повышение производительности в распределенных системах и улучшение работы с большими объемами данных. Переход на новую мажорную версию — это не просто установка обновлений, это смена парадигмы работы ядра системы.
В версии 8.4 значительно переработан механизм работы с памятью и многопоточностью, что особенно критично для серверов с большим количеством ядер процессора. Если ваша инфраструктура построена на современном оборудовании, использование старой версии платформы может стать «бутылочным горлышком», не позволяющим раскрыть потенциал железа. При этом стоит учитывать, что некоторые устаревшие внешние обработки и расширения могут потребовать доработки кода.
⚠️ Внимание: Перед обновлением платформы до версии 8.4 обязательно проверьте список сертифицированных конфигураций на официальном сайте фирмы «1С». Не все старые решения поддерживают работу на новой платформе без модификации кода.
Важным аспектом является поддержка операционных систем. Новые версии платформы часто выходят с оптимизацией под последние релизы Windows Server и дистрибутивы Linux. Если ваш парк серверов работает на устаревших ОС, попытка установить свежую платформу может привести к нестабильности службы сервера 1С:Предприятия.
Всегда делайте полную резервную копию базы данных и каталога конфигурации перед обновлением платформы. Откат версии платформы — это сложная и рискованная процедура.
Файловая или клиент-серверная архитектура
Выбор между файловым и клиент-серверным вариантом — это выбор между простотой развертывания и надежностью хранения данных. Файловая база данных хранит всю информацию в одном или нескольких файлах на диске, что делает её идеальным решением для небольших компаний с числом пользователей до 5-10 человек. Администрирование такой системы не требует специальных знаний: достаточно иметь доступ к общей папке в сети.
Однако при росте нагрузки файловый вариант начинает демонстрировать серьезные проблемы с производительностью и целостностью данных. Блокировки файлов при одновременной записи несколькими пользователями могут приводить к зависаниям и даже повреждению структуры базы. В таких случаях неизбежен переход на технологию SQL-серверов, таких как Microsoft SQL Server или PostgreSQL.
- 🚀 Файловый вариант: прост в настройке, не требует лицензий на СУБД, идеален для автономной работы.
- 🛡️ Клиент-серверный вариант: обеспечивает высокую надежность, транзакционную защиту и поддержку сотен пользователей.
- ⚙️ Гибридные сценарии: возможность использования файловой базы как локального кэша для удаленных сотрудников.
Клиент-серверный режим требует установки и настройки отдельного программного обеспечения — сервера баз данных. Это влечет за собой дополнительные затраты на лицензии (в случае MS SQL) или на квалифицированных администраторов (в случае PostgreSQL). Тем не менее, для бизнеса, где простой системы означает прямые убытки, эти затраты являются оправданной инвестицией в стабильность.
Требования к аппаратному обеспечению
Производительность платформы 1С:Предприятие напрямую зависит от характеристик серверного оборудования. Основными узкими местами чаще всего становятся дисковая подсистема и объем оперативной памяти. Использование традиционных жестких дисков (HDD) для баз данных в 2026 году уже считается моветоном, так как скорость случайного чтения и записи критически влияет на время выполнения запросов.
Для сервера 1С:Предприятия рекомендуется выделять отдельный физический или виртуальный сервер. Совмещение роли контроллера домена, файлового сервера и сервера 1С на одной машине — это грубая ошибка, которая приведет к конфликту ресурсов и падению производительности всей сети предприятия при пиковых нагрузках, например, во время закрытия месяца.
| Компонент | Минимальные требования | Рекомендуемые требования | Оптимально для 50+ пользователей |
|---|---|---|---|
| Процессор | 2 ядра, 2.0 ГГц | 4 ядра, 3.0 ГГц | 8+ ядер, высокая частота |
| Оперативная память | 4 ГБ | 16 ГБ | 64 ГБ и выше |
| Дисковая система | HDD 7200 об/мин | SSD SATA | NVMe SSD RAID 10 |
| Сеть | 100 Мбит/с | 1 Гбит/с | 10 Гбит/с |
Особое внимание следует уделить конфигурации RAID-массивов. Для файловых баз данных и журналов транзакций SQL-сервера необходимо использовать уровни с зеркалированием или чередованием, чтобы обеспечить отказоустойчивость. Потеря диска в массиве без резервирования может остановить работу всей компании на дни.
Лицензирование и типы клиентов
Вопрос лицензирования часто вызывает путаницу у бухгалтеров и руководителей. Платформа 1С требует наличия лицензий на использование, которые могут быть сетевыми или локальными. Выбор типа лицензии зависит от того, как организовано рабочее место пользователей и планируется ли использование тонкого или веб-клиента.
Тонкий клиент предоставляет полный функционал работы с базой данных и является основным инструментом для большинства пользователей. Веб-клиент позволяет работать через браузер, что удобно для удаленных сотрудников, но имеет ряд ограничений по функциональности и требует установки веб-сервера (например, Apache или IIS). Для работы через веб-интерфейс также требуются специальные лицензии.
Как считаются лицензии при комбинированном доступе?
Если у вас есть 5 лицензий на тонкий клиент и 5 на веб-клиент, это не значит, что одновременно могут работать 10 человек. Лицензии суммируются только в рамках одного типа подключения или при использовании конвертируемых лицензий.
Существует также понятие «лицензии на сервер 1С:Предприятия». Они необходимы, если количество подключений превышает определенное количество или если используется кластер серверов. Игнорирование лицензионной чистоты может привести к штрафам при проверке, поэтому важно вести строгий учет ключей защиты.
⚠️ Внимание: Лицензии на платформу и лицензии на конфигурацию (например, «1С:Бухгалтерия») — это разные продукты. Наличие лицензии на программу не дает права запускать платформу без отдельного ключа защиты.
Безопасность и разграничение прав
Безопасность учетной системы — это не только защита от вирусов, но и грамотное разграничение прав доступа внутри самой платформы. Встроенные роли позволяют гибко настраивать, кто может видеть документы, а кто имеет право только на просмотр. Неправильная настройка профилей групп доступа является одной из самых частых причин утечек коммерческой информации.
При выборе платформы стоит учитывать возможности аудита действий пользователей. В современных версиях доступен подробный журнал регистрации, который позволяет отследить, кто, когда и какие данные изменил. Эта функция становится обязательной при работе с персональными данными и финансовой отчетностью.
Для защиты канала передачи данных между клиентом и сервером рекомендуется использовать шифрование. Особенно это актуально, если сотрудники подключаются к базе извне офиса через интернет. Настройка SSL-сертификатов на стороне веб-сервера или использование VPN-туннелей является стандартной практикой безопасности.
Правильно настроенные роли доступа снижают риск человеческой ошибки и предотвращают несанкционированное изменение критических данных.
Миграция и обновление системы
Процесс обновления платформы и конфигурации должен проводиться в строгой последовательности. Сначала обновляется платформа на сервере и клиентах, затем делается выгрузка и загрузка конфигурации базы данных, и только после этого выполняется обновление самой конфигурации до новой версии. Нарушение этого порядка часто приводит к ошибкам компиляции модулей.
При миграции с одной версии платформы на другую (например, с 8.3.10 на 8.3.20) может потребоваться конвертация базы данных. Этот процесс может занимать от нескольких минут до нескольких часов в зависимости от размера базы. В это время доступ пользователей к системе должен быть полностью заблокирован.
- 📅 Планируйте обновление на нерабочее время (выходные или ночь).
- 💾 Всегда имейте «точку отката» — свежую копию базы перед началом работ.
- 🧪 Тестируйте обновление на копии базы, а не на рабочей среде.
Автоматизация процесса обновления возможна с использованием ключей командной строки. Например, запуск платформы в режиме предприятия с ключом /UpdateDBCfg позволяет обновить конфигурацию базы данных без вмешательства пользователя. Это удобно при массовом обновлении множества баз в крупной организации.
1cv8.exe /F "C:\Bases\Base1" /N "Admin" /P "Password" /UpdateDBCfg
⚠️ Внимание: Параметры командной строки и пути к исполняемым файлам могут отличаться в зависимости от разрядности системы (x86/x64) и способа установки (файловый/сетевой). Всегда проверяйте актуальный синтаксис в документации разработчика.
Часто задаваемые вопросы (FAQ)
Можно ли работать на платформе 8.3 с конфигурацией, написанной под 8.4?
Нет, это невозможно. Конфигурации, разработанные с использованием новых возможностей платформы 8.4, не будут работать на старых версиях ядра. Требуется обновление платформы до версии, соответствующей или выше версии конфигурации.
Какой сервер баз данных лучше выбрать: MS SQL или PostgreSQL?
MS SQL Server традиционно считается более производительным и простым в администрировании для 1С, но он платный. PostgreSQL — бесплатное решение, которое в последних версиях демонстрирует отличную производительность, но требует более высокой квалификации администратора для тонкой настройки.
Нужно ли переустанавливать платформу при обновлении конфигурации?
Обычно нет. Обновление конфигурации (например, с версии 3.0.100 на 3.0.105) не требует смены версии платформы. Однако, если новая версия конфигурации требует функций, появившихся только в свежем релизе платформы, тогда обновление ядра обязательно.
Как узнать текущую версию платформы?
Запустите 1С в режиме предприятия, зайдите в меню «О программе» (обычно в разделе «Администрирование» или в заголовке окна). Там будет указана полная версия платформы и номер сборки.
Влияет ли версия Windows на выбор версии 1С?
Да, влияет. Новые версии платформы 1С могут не поддерживаться на устаревших операционных системах (например, Windows 7 или Server 2008 R2). Перед обновлением сверьтесь с таблицей совместимости на сайте поддержки 1С.